Ringing in the ears
Ringing in the ears: right ear means praise, left means criticism. First recorded in Roman era; Pliny records it as a sign of being discussed, it is about 1976 years old — the 10th oldest of the 40 superstitions we have dated. Tinnitus, affecting roughly 15% of adults, most often from noise exposure. Persistent ringing in one ear only is a medical sign, not a social one.

Same family as itchy palms and twitching eyes: a small unexplained sensation given social meaning. Pliny the Elder recorded the belief that ringing ears mean someone is speaking of you, and it has barely changed since.
